Salary of Sociology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$35,722 Bachelor's Median Salary

Sociology graduates with a bachelor’s degree from UNCP earn a median of $35,722 a year. This is lower than $47,113, the median for all majors at UNCP.

Student Debt of Sociology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$28,526 Bachelor's Median Debt

While getting their bachelor’s degree at UNCP, sociology students borrow a median amount of $28,526 in student loans. This is higher than $27,089, the typical median for all majors at UNCP.

Bachelor’s Student Diversity

For the most recent academic year available, 16% of sociology bachelor’s degrees went to men and 84% went to women.

UNCP gender breakdown of Sociology Bachelor's degree grads The largest share of sociology bachelor’s degree graduates at UNCP are White. Roughly 37% of graduates fell into this category.
